Time Poverty
The feeling of having insufficient time to accomplish all of one's tasks, leading to stress and a lower quality of life.
Car Selection
The process of choosing a vehicle based on criteria such as needs, preferences, budget, and performance specifications.
Reduced Time
Strategies or measures implemented to decrease the amount of time required to perform a task or process, often leading to increased efficiency.
Crowding
A situation where excess demand in a confined space or system leads to uncomfortable or inefficient conditions, often observed in urban areas, public transport, or event management.
